Output 61f511c86ebabd31cba7a68481a264370dbb7ad99f5084f78176f8c42bc5a908:765

value
152882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ebfddafde5d86385e1b875318a2ecafdd0cc114c33cf69ea39a1ab8cbabe3748
address
tb1pa07a4l09mp3ctcdcw5cc5tk2lhgvcy2vx08kn63e5x4cew47xayqsx8p43
transaction
61f511c86ebabd31cba7a68481a264370dbb7ad99f5084f78176f8c42bc5a908
confirmations
21452
spent
false

2 Sat Ranges